In summary by the way;
Paladin is best if you're cha-based and can take it, Ranger is best if you're fighting one kind of enemy, Vigilante is best if you want two identities.
From there Fighter is a great default choice, Slayer gets you solid skill points and skill list while still contributing to general combat, and the Occultist is the only dip that will help your spellcasting.
Bloodrager, Cavalier, and Samurai all over a variety of quirky options to shop around for if you want, though most aren't worth giving up a combat feat.
Finally, you could take a dip in Aristocrat and be an eldritch knight if you really really want to.

The Mad Magic makes Bloodrager much more appealing.
As far as Gunslinger goes, there are archetypes to make it either Int-based or Cha-based. The Sorcerer/Mysterious Stranger in particular can be brutal, since you've got Cha-to-damage and a huge grit pool.
Also, be sure to give a PSA for prestigious spellcaster. Buying back that lost level of spellcasting progression is a big deal for the EK, since his entire niche to begin with is having better spells than the Magus.

He didn't mean actually taking levels in Oracle (although that does technically work so I suppose it deserves a perfunctory listing), but rather using the Variant Multiclassing alternate rules. This trades out your 3rd level feat for a revelation, which you use to pick skill at arms. This allows you to qualify for Eldritch Knight as a Wizard 5.

While I think the VMC Oracle is a good (green) option, I would not put it blue. Back before Prestigious Spellcaster existed it was the only way to "buy back" caster levels, but now it faces direct competition from that feat chain. There are lots of great feats and feat chains for your Eldritch Knight, and this path greatly restricts your ability to grab them.
